Output 20e2eb896d5c721c4b8bfe949ba7f28b823716ee71b8db95e20d33cd0f5981f5:20

value
66440250
script pubkey
OP_0 OP_PUSHBYTES_20 7c140b19dc13faa219ffc9c874bd56c4953b66fd
address
ltc1q0s2qkxwuz0a2yx0le8y8f02kcj2nkehajwjnz0
transaction
20e2eb896d5c721c4b8bfe949ba7f28b823716ee71b8db95e20d33cd0f5981f5
spent
true